Grace Frye Tallies Second Podium Finish At #HLTF Indoor Championships

Grace Frye Tallies Second Podium Finish At #HLTF Indoor Championships

YOUNGSTOWN, Ohio - The Cleveland State track & field team closed out action at the 2024 Horizon League Indoor Track & Field Championships Sunday, paced by Grace Frye with a podium finish in the Shot Put.

Frye tallied her second podium finish in as many days with a fifth place showing in the Shot Put, posting a mark of 13.31. Frye's mark of 13.31 topped her previous school record that she set earlier this season.

In addition to Frye, Karly Klaer (13th-11.82) and Landry Driskel (14th-11.55) both notched top-15 performances in the Shot Put.

Natalie Keller tallied Cleveland State's top individual finish in track events Sunday, placing 18th in the 3000 Meter Run with a time of 10:32.80.

Cleveland State's 4x400 relay team of Madison Morris, Julia Rapp, Melinda Brown, and Leah Hoover recorded a time of 4:11.39 to finish ninth.

This weekend's #HLTF Indoor Championships marked the ninth and final meet for the Vikings during the indoor slate.
